-3

愿意利用 Tango 库以及 DMD 1 编译器 (v1.076) 的最新版本,我在网上搜索该捆绑包是徒劳的。

那怎么能建?


解决了:

我已经设法用 Tango 构建了 DMD 1 v1.076。看这里我的回答。

4

2 回答 2

2

为什么你需要一个捆绑包,特别是?

这是官方捆绑包下载:

http://dsource.org/projects/tango/wiki/TopicInstallTangoDmd

您也可以单独下载更新的编译器,但 Tango 可能无法与最新的开箱即用编译器一起使用 - 您可能需要在几个地方更新代码才能构建它。


Tango 不再由其创建者维护,这就是下载内容有一段时间没有更新的原因。一些志愿者可能正在维护使用最新 D 版本的 Tango 的分支。例如,这里是一个 D2 分支:https ://github.com/SiegeLord/Tango-D2

于 2013-05-22T13:28:44.717 回答
0

分享我的发现:

我终于成功地构建了一个DMD 1.076 与 Tango 作为库 (Win32)捆绑包。

我按照Tango 网站中提到的有关 Win32 平台的详细步骤进行操作。

它适用于DMD 1.071版本以后。

private extern (Windows)我必须通过将一行代码更改protected extern (Windows)为一个模块来解决一个问题。

我注意到自从我之前使用的捆绑包 (DMD1.056/Tango 0.99.9) 以来,Tango 库发生了一些变化。

于 2013-05-27T08:39:47.923 回答